Urgent Care Video Visits are available for all adult (age 18 and older) U-M Health patients who have received care from U-M in the last 36 months. You must be enrolled in the MyUofMHealth Patient Portal to use an Urgent Care Video Visit. You must be physically located in the State of Michigan at the time of your Video Visit due to state law and ... You may request access to the MyUofMHealth account of your child, spouse, parent or others you care for. To request access to another person's account, you must first activate a MyUofMHealth account for yourself.
